About Europcar International’s Workforce
Europcar International SASU is a Logistics and Transportation company that employs 16,096 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 8th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 1949, the company is headquartered in Paris, France.
Europcar International's workforce has declined 5.2% from 2023 to 2026, down 1.9% year over year in 2026. It fell to a low of 16,096 in 2026 Q1 before recovering. Its workforce is concentrated most in Western Europe (24.3%), followed by Northern Europe (19.8%) and Southern Europe (16.8%).
Europcar International's functional groups are Engineering (33.5%), Finance and Operations (33.4%), and Sales and Marketing (33.2%). The average salary is $31,080, ranging from a median of $39,000 in Western Europe to $6,000 in Sub-Saharan Africa.
Europcar International's active job postings fell 81.9% in 2026 to 80, with new postings per month climbing from 32 in 2023 to 45 in 2026. Overall employee sentiment is negative and declining.
